Transaction 123cfcad276c92a1f152cff91c245b0e4de4c78d97a92b00fc11005a800c819a
1 Input
1 Output
-
123cfcad276c92a1f152cff91c245b0e4de4c78d97a92b00fc11005a800c819a:0
- value
- 303668339
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bd98b83322b606b6be8593f8a9e585be111419a
- address
- bc1qe0vchqej9dsxk6lgtylc48jct0s3zsv67ls4wu